What Is A PPC Conversion Rate?

PPC conversion rate is the percentage of users who complete a desired action—such as making a purchase, filling out a form, or calling a business—after clicking on a pay-per-click advertisement.

Why Ppc Conversion Rate Matters

Tracking your PPC conversion rate helps you understand the direct return on investment (ROI) of your advertising spend. A higher conversion rate means:

  • Lower Customer Acquisition Costs: You get more value out of every dollar spent on clicks.
  • Better Ad Quality Scores: Platforms like Google Ads reward relevant landing pages and high engagement with lower cost-per-click (CPC).
  • Clear Budget Allocation: It shows which campaigns, ad groups, and keywords drive actual revenue rather than empty traffic.

Mechanics

How Ppc Conversion Rate Works

PPC conversion rate calculation follows a straightforward formula:

Conversion Rate = (Total Conversions / Total Clicks) × 100

The Process:

  • Set Up Conversion Tracking: Place tracking tags (like Google Tag or Meta Pixel) on thank-you pages or purchase confirmation screens.
  • Drive Targeted Clicks: Run ads targeting high-intent keywords to send relevant users to a dedicated landing page.
  • Measure Actions: The platform records when a user completes the defined goal after clicking your ad.
  • Optimize: Analyze the conversion rate against industry benchmarks and adjust ad copy, targeting, or landing page design to improve performance.

Application

Ppc Conversion Rate Example

A local plumbing company spends $1,000 on Google Ads, generating 200 clicks to a specialized emergency repair landing page. Out of those 200 visitors, 20 people fill out the service request form.

Using the formula: (20 conversions / 200 clicks) × 100 = 10% PPC conversion rate.

Advantages

Benefits Of A Ppc Conversion Rate

  • Improves Profit Margins: Maximizes revenue without requiring an increase in your total ad budget.
  • Identifies Weak Landing Pages: Pinpoints pages that fail to persuade visitors to act.
  • Informs Keyword Strategy: Highlights which search terms generate qualified leads versus passive browsers.
  • Lowers Cost Per Acquisition (CPA): Reduces the average amount of ad spend needed to gain a single customer.

Pitfalls

Ppc Conversion Rate Mistakes

  • Sending Traffic to the Homepage: Directing clicks to a generic homepage instead of a dedicated, targeted landing page.
  • Weak Call to Action (CTA): Using vague buttons like “Submit” instead of direct actions like “Get Your Free Quote.”
  • Ignoring Mobile Experience: Failing to test page speed and mobile form usability where most clicks happen.
  • Tracking Irrelevant Actions: Counting low-value interactions (like viewing a page for 5 seconds) as conversions, skewing performance data.

Questions

Ppc Conversion Rate FAQ

What is a good PPC conversion rate?

Across most industries on Google Ads, the average conversion rate is around 3% to 5%. However, high-intent local services or e-commerce flash sales can see conversion rates of 10% or higher.

How does landing page design affect PPC conversion rates?

Landing page design directly dictates conversion rates. A clear headline matching the ad copy, fast load speeds, minimal distractions, and a clear call-to-action make it easy for users to convert.

What is the difference between CTR and PPC conversion rate?

Click-Through Rate (CTR) measures the percentage of people who click your ad after seeing it. PPC conversion rate measures how many of those clickers complete a valuable action on your website.
